Furthermore, an update was made to the Breakaway Audio Enhancer installation process itself. As of version 1.44, the installer for Breakaway Audio Enhancer no longer automatically includes the Breakaway Pipeline driver. This change was made to prevent conflicts with different versions of virtual audio cables that users might have installed on their system. The software divides your audio signal into multiple frequency bands. It adjusts the volume of each band independently. This ensures that quiet dialogue in a movie becomes crisp and audible, while sudden, loud explosions are kept at a safe, non-distorting level. 2. Automatic Volume Leveling
